Job description

Job Description

Company: Electric Vehicle Company

Opportunity: Our client is looking for a Lead Electronics Test Engineer who will be responsible for developing and certifying testing of low voltage system electronics for our electric aircraft.

Requirements: You have 8+ years of experience developing and modifying functional test protocols in the aerospace or aviation industry.

Core responsibilities:

  • Develop formal test plans, procedures, instrumentation plans, test stand/fixture designs, and data acquisition architectures for thorough and repeatable testing of electronics.
  • Identify test objectives, instrumentation needs, devise test matrices, and define detailed test procedures.
  • Procure appropriate and configuration-controlled test articles and prepare them with appropriate instrumentation for a given test.
  • Work closely with test equipment design engineers to define requirements and expectations of the test stand.
  • Perform post-test failure inspection, diagnose failures by identifying root cause, document findings, and provide feedback for design improvement.
  • Verify that the airborne electronic hardware meets or exceeds design requirements and provide necessary testing information/documentation for FAA certification requirements.
  • Contribute to the technical writing of Qualification Test Plans and Procedures (QTP) during submission for FAA approval.
  • Execute witnessed tests for certification credit after acceptance of QTPs by DER and FAA.

Required qualifications:

  • B.S. in Mechanical or Electrical Engineering with 8+ years of work experience in Test Engineering OR M.S. with 6+ years of experience.
  • Experience developing and modifying functional test protocols.
  • Experience with multiple environmental tests: thermal cycling, humidity, salt fog, fluid proofness, vibration, and shock.
  • Experience with instrumentation used for environmental tests (e.g., multimeters, accelerometers, thermistors, current probes).
  • Experience with electromagnetic environments such as lightning, high-intensity radiated field, voltage spikes, and power interruptions.

Ideal candidate:

  • Experience with testing electronics hardware to DO-160, MIL-810, or similar standards.
  • Experience with root cause analysis of electronics failure.
  • Experience with Matlab/Python.
  • Experience with LabView.
